ZIP 24221 and ZIP 24228 are ZIP Code areas in Virginia.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 24228 has the higher population (6,336 vs 717 in ZIP 24221). ZIP 24221 has the higher median household income ($51,719 vs $44,269 in ZIP 24228). ZIP 24221 has the higher median home value ($121,300 vs $105,200 in ZIP 24228).
